A study was done in 2008 investigating the brain and its blood supply of the agouti and of the rabbit. Many studies have been done involving the agouti but none of its brain. The agouti is evolving from a sole wildlife animal to a laboratory model and even as an exotic pet, hence the need to further this area of study. Some interesting results came about this study which will help further evolution and may even start the replacement of the rabbit with the agouti.
